Canadian pollsters look to have done very well last night, but the common theme continues: party of the Right, the Conservatives, look to be underscored by 1.5% on average across final polls.

Just got the guys to look at our latest online survey and took a simple mean interview length divided by number of questions to give 19 secs but the median was just 7secs. Hmm, Interesting.
All surveys and survey questions are different so getting a precise number is unreliable though.
